How the In-Game Economy Works

Your primary currency is cash, earned by placing blocks to extend your bridge toward the sniper tower. Each block placed adds to your total, but the real earning rate depends on how quickly you can collect and place those blocks. Two upgrades directly fuel this loop: increased block carrying capacity and speed coils. More blocks per trip means more cash per minute, and faster travel means more trips per minute.

The second economic pillar is the Sniper Rebirth System. When you eliminate a builder and get reborn, you receive 10 ammo and a 1.2x cash multiplier. This multiplier applies to every block you place afterward, so aggressive sniping is not just about winning; it is a legitimate cash farm strategy. The multiplier stacks multiplicatively, so a sniper who racks up several eliminations quickly becomes the richest player on the server.

Best Farming and Earning Methods

Early game, focus on building straight toward the tower. Avoid fancy detours that waste blocks and time. Your first purchases should always prioritize carry capacity. Going from 10 blocks to 20 blocks per haul doubles your income per trip, which compounds quickly. After two or three capacity upgrades, invest in speed coils to cut travel time.

As the sniper, target builders who are furthest ahead. Each elimination triggers the rebirth bonus, giving you 10 more ammo and another 1.2x multiplier. If you string together three fast kills, you are earning 1.728x cash from that point forward. Stacking multipliers is the single fastest way to outpace every other player on the server. For the most efficient farming, wait until several builders cluster on a narrow choke point, then fire through them to chain kills quickly.

When to Switch Between Builder and Sniper

The best economy players know when to abandon building and take the sniper seat. If you are less than five blocks from the tower, sprint for it. That prime position grants you a powerful offensive tool and the ability to trigger rebirth bonuses repeatedly. If you are still far away, keep building and buy defensive items to protect your progress. Once you become the sniper, do not camp the tower forever; your goal is to eliminate builders, reset the timer, and keep your multiplier climbing.

Items That Hold or Gain Value

Not all upgrades are equal over the long term. Carry capacity and speed coils maintain value for the whole match because they directly boost your block placement rate. Shields become increasingly valuable when RPGs and rockets start flying; one shield can save you from losing a 20-block stretch that would cost thousands in rebuild time. Use the shield strategically to push toward the tower safely when the enemy sniper is watching an open section. Smoke and flashbangs are situational but invaluable for crossing exposed sections or disorienting a sniper who is lining you up.

The most valuable asset is the Sniper Rebirth multiplier. Unlike one-time items, this multiplier keeps scaling the more kills you get. It never resets during the run, so a sniper who survives and racks up eliminations becomes an economic powerhouse. Pair it with a defensive shield to avoid losing your streak to a rival sniper.

FAQ

Q: How many Sniper Rebirth kills do I need to double my cash multiplier in Build to Become Sniper?

A: Each elimination gives a 1.2x multiplier, and the bonus stacks multiplicatively. To roughly double your cash, you need four consecutive rebirth kills (1.2^4 = 2.0736). Three kills give you 1.728x, so four is the sweet spot for a noticeable leap in block income.

Q: Should I buy speed coils or carry capacity first in Build to Become Sniper?

A: Always prioritize carry capacity first. Doubling your block haul from 10 to 20 blocks effectively doubles your cash per trip. Speed coils only shave a few seconds off travel, so they should be bought after two or three capacity upgrades to maximize your income per minute.

Q: What is the best way to use the shield item in Build to Become Sniper?

A: Use the shield to safely close distance toward the sniper tower when you know a sniper has you in their scope. You can also deploy it after a rocket attack to push through a destroyed section before enemies rebuild. Combine it with smoke to cross open stretches without taking damage.
